In today’s Energy Source, we take a breath from oil and turn towards critical minerals.
My FT colleague Martha Muir writes today about a new report warning that western critical minerals projects are being hamstrung by public funding gaps. This is impeding their ability to challenge China’s chokehold on materials essential to tech and defence manufacturing, according to Safe’s Center for Critical Minerals Strategy, a non-governmental organisation.
Over the weekend, Edward White reported on record funding in China’s Belt and Road infrastructure programme, which rose to $126.3bn in the first half of 2026, including $20.1bn for green energy financing. The BRI has played a substantial role in Beijing’s control of critical minerals — Indonesia, for example, is the primary exporter of nickel thanks in part to BRI financing, and sent 98 per cent of ferronickel exports to China in the first five months of this year.
And on Monday, William Wallis reported from Kenya about plans to develop a $62bn rare earth deposit that is also a sacred site to the Digo people.
Amid all of this is the backdrop of China’s systematic dominance over the metals needed for a green transition, which I report on today.

China’s grip on electrification metals raises inflation risk
The global push for energy security faces new challenges as the world shifts towards renewables and China dominates the suite of metals required for them.
The FT earlier this month reported that Chinese control of rare earth metals has caused “panic” and “existential risk” for the semiconductor industry. The International Energy Agency reported shortly after that Beijing’s export controls could put $6.5tn per year of downstream production outside the Asian nation at risk.
But China’s supply-chain dominance extends to the common metals needed for electrification too, posing major risks for the green transition.
Natalie Biggs, head of base metals markets at Wood Mackenzie, told Energy Source: “The world is increasingly reliant on technology, and that means metals really . . . Now that we’ve got the rise of renewable generation, we’re even reliant on it for power reasons.”
China is the leading refiner of nearly every metal needed for renewable energy. So-called electrification metals such as copper, lithium, nickel and cobalt are crucial for the manufacturing of green technologies including solar, wind and batteries. If battery-grade graphite trade were disrupted, for example, more than $300bn of downstream production outside China would be at risk.
The top refining country for each of these metals — China in every case except nickel — accounted for an average 72 per cent share in 2025, up from 70 per cent in 2023. This is barely projected to shift over the next three decades, according to projections released by the IEA earlier this month.
Colin Williams, who has been a geophysicist at the US Geological Survey for more than three decades, said: “We’re already dependent on many of the mineral commodities that are needed for renewable energy and evolving electrification to an extent that we consider critical.”
“Our processing capability is not even enough to refine the copper that we mine ourselves,” he told Energy Source.
In a working paper released by the National Bureau of Economic Research last week, economists used policy and bilateral trade data to show how China has reorganised electrification metals into a “hub-and-spoke system”, despite being endowed with very little of the natural resources themselves. This marks a significant departure from fossil fuels, which have diffuse supply chains and are buffered by strategic reserves and deep markets.
“There is a little bit of a parallelism [of] China’s centrality with the state of the US as a global hegemony,” Evgenia Passari, one of the paper’s authors, told Energy Source. “We think that this big centrality of China was built by choice, by strategic choice, by strategic financing in those big important exporters of those metals.”
Using an analysis of more than 8mn news articles to identify commodity-specific supply and demand shocks, the researchers also developed a model to determine how China’s grip on supply chains could affect inflation.
They found that a one-standard deviation decrease in the supply of electrification metals raises the cumulative level of consumer prices by roughly one percentage point in the US and the EU over the following two years, about twice the effect of a comparable fossil fuel shock and significantly longer lasting.
The authors wrote: “The transition from fossil fuels does not abolish strategic dependence; it relocates it from hydrocarbon reserves . . . to mineral processing chains, which are concentrated, thin and slow to replicate.”
In response to foreign supply chain reliance made clear since the Covid-19 pandemic, the US has made some efforts to buffer risks. On February 2, the White House announced the creation of a critical minerals reserve alongside the US Export-Import Bank. The reserve, called Project Vault, is backed by a $10bn Exim loan and nearly $2bn in private-sector investment.
Exim told Energy Source: “Foreign adversaries have the ability to chokehold the American supply chain. That’s why this is one tool in the US government’s toolkit to ensure that there’s other options for American manufacturers.”
Australia, Japan, South Korea and China are the only other countries with significant critical minerals stockpiles, according to the IEA.
Securing critical minerals was an important part of last month’s summit of G7 countries in France. “In light of the high degree of market concentration, the need to reduce vulnerabilities regarding [critical minerals] . . . we recall the urgency of diversifying our supply chains”, the leaders announced.
However, their commitments to diversify their supply chains only focused on rare earths and permanent magnets.
“For other critical minerals, we task the relevant ministers with setting a specific target for reducing these dependencies before the end of the year,” the leaders said.
